Sound is slower than light because sound waves travel through a medium, such as air or water, by vibrating particles and transferring energy. Light, on the other hand, travels through a vacuum at a constant speed of about 186,282 miles per second because it is made up of electromagnetic waves that do not require a medium to propagate.

Sound is the vibration of molecules and atoms. Light is made up of things called "light quanta" or "photons." This means that sound cannot travel through a vacuum (there are obviously no molecules or atoms in a vacuum to transmit sound) but light can.
